This is a long, 173 page collection of scales and lip building exercises. They are accompanied by 58 selected studies performed by Cheal on compact disc at moderate tempos. The book includes numerous modes, arpeggios, and original exercises, each of which runs through all tonal centers. Range is not a major concern and is well within the province of a reasonably accomplished player. Other jazz trombone books cover specific areas touched upon by Cheal, such as the whys and wherefores of jazz theory, across the grain playing, lip slurs, doodle tonguing and the like. To fit the needs of an all-purpose source, however, one is hard-pressed to find a better all-in-one collection of technical and improvisational study. -Joel Elias Sacramento State University
